Transaction 3318d7652561614efb5b0ed5e719b232a0838814bc5c2a61c452ad810a840049
1 Input
1 Output
-
3318d7652561614efb5b0ed5e719b232a0838814bc5c2a61c452ad810a840049:0
- value
- 10012137
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f77bb19ef40765a155aab5af78d5c451228ccac OP_EQUAL
- address
- 3BrQMtBTpppVkcrFZZGvHaq4nGnQQkuSnp